20W50μJ IR Femtosecond Laser
Features:
User-friendly interface
Real-time state monitoring
High beam quality; Suitable for precision processing
Narrow pulse femtosecond; Excellent pulse quality and excellent stability
Low-cost; maintenance-free
Beam Roundness:>90%
Beam Quality:TEM00(M²<1.4)
Pulse width:<400fs
Max Energy:>50μJ@400KHz
Power:>20W@400KHz
Applications:
OLED processing
